vMotionとは?VMware環境での仮想マシン移動の基本概念を解説
仮想化技術が普及するにつれ、仮想マシンの移動がより重要な役割を担うようになってきました。その中でも、VMware環境で使われる「vMotion」は特に注目されています。
では、vMotionとは何でしょうか?
簡単に言うと、vMotionは物理的に異なるサーバー間で動作中の仮想マシンを移動するための機能です。これによって、稼働中の仮想マシンを中断することなく、リソースの不足や障害発生などに対応することができます。
では、具体的にどのような場合にvMotionが使われるのでしょうか?
・サーバーのメンテナンス
・リソースのバランシング
・障害発生時の復旧
などが挙げられます。
vMotionを実現するためには、以下の条件が必要です。
1. ストレージの共有
2. ネットワークの共有
3. ホスト間のVMkernelポートの設定
これらが整っていれば、vMotionは利用可能となります。
vMotionは、従来の物理的なサーバー環境では不可能だった「仮想マシンの移動」を実現するものであり、仮想化技術の利点の1つと言えます。
この機能を活用することで、より柔軟な運用が可能となり、システムの可用性や信頼性の向上につながります。